Fabien Foret will return to the Kawasaki fold with the Lorenzini by Leoni Kawasaki World Supersport squad in 2010, and the 2002 World Champion spoke to us about his joy at landing such a strong ride. Foret has every reason to be happy returning to the Kawasaki family, having won races twice before on Ninja machinery; at Misano in 2003 on a ZX-6RR operated by the Kawasaki Racing Team, and at Phillip Island in 2007 on a ZX-6R, in the GIL Kawasaki squad. Fabien Foret: “I am very happy to have finalised a deal between Kawasaki, Lorenzini by Leoni and myself. I am sure we can manage a good job, and be one of the top runners. We will improve step-by-step, bike, team and rider, and our target is to be top five, maybe higher. Why not maybe even better than that? After only two winter tests we still have some things to do, but this is a great chance for me. We are not a full factory team, but that also means we do not have the same pressure, and we can concentrate on our season preparations.” He continued, “I am very happy with Lorenzini by Leoni, they are a very professional Italian team, and in my opinion the bike is very good and suits me well. I have won races in WSS with Kawasaki two times in the past, and those are good memories. I think the Kawasaki is one of the best bikes in WSS now so my expectations are already high. I know Kawasaki has an official team in 2010, with Joan Lascorz and Katsuaki Fujiwara, but with my experience and fighting spirit, both my team and Kawasaki can expect to have good results from me as well.” Vanni Lorenzini, Lorenzini by Leoni Team Manager, stated: “I’m really satisfied about our new accord with Kawasaki.
